Birr Definitions
1 of 2) Birr, Purr, Whir, Whirr, Whiz, Whizz : دھیمی موٹر وغیرہ گھومنے کی آواز : (verb) make a soft swishing sound.
2 of 2) Birr, Whir, Whirr, Whirring : زناٹے کی آواز : (noun) sound of something in rapid motion.
